ORIGINAL: md420

Main thing will be to run a good amount of fuel to keep cyl temps down
What does fuel have to do with keeping the temps down in a turbocharged engine?

more air = more heat which in turn ='s "knock". This is what kills most performance builds, But the more fuel you add the cooler the temps go in the cyl walls. Now I aint saying to go out and run it pig rich flooding it out or anything but my main point is that if you stay in a good target air/fuel ratio range, pull timing correctly, and do not beat on a engine it will serve you good.
